Germany's ambassador to Iran resumes duties in Tehran

The German Ambassador to Iran, Markus Motsel, who left Iran on October 30, returned to Tehran a few days ago and resumed his duties.

Axar.az reports that this information was released by the German Ministry of Foreign Affairs.

It should be noted that after the execution of German citizen Jamshid Sharmahd in Tehran on October 29, the German Ministry of Foreign Affairs had recalled the ambassador from Tehran.
